[224]-247) and index. 327 $aBook Cover; Title; Contents; List of illustrations; Preface; The economic theory of schooling markets: an introduction; Education and the economy: examining the context of schooling markets; Parents, pupils, schools and teachers: the microeconomics of schooling; Market reforms: funding and open enrolment; Market reforms: parental choice in an open enrolment system; Market reforms: licensing, training and remuneration of teachers; Governance, monitoring and performance indicators; Schools in the market place; Conclusions; References; Index 330 $aNick Adnett and Peter Davies develop an economic analysis of schooling markets, emphasizing both the strengths and weaknesses of orthodox analyses. They explain the economic and social contexts that have generated the widespread desire to reform state schooling and develop a systematic analysis of the key policy components examining both theory and international evidence. The authors employ a unique framework based upon economic analysis that is informed by research performed by educationalists and other social scientists. The eleven papers inside the book provide an overview of remote sensing applications on hydro, solar, wind and geothermal energy resources and their major goal is to provide state of art knowledge to contribute with the renewable energy resource deployment, especially in regions where energy demand is rapidly expanding. Renewable energy resources have an intrinsic relationship with local environmental features and the regional climate. Even small and fast environment and/or climate changes can cause significant variability in power generation at different time and space scales. Methodologies based on remote sensing are the primary source of information for the development of numerical models that aim to support the planning and operation of an electric system with a substantial contribution of intermittent energy sources.
